Overview
Dr. Jangs lab uses multi-disciplinary approaches to study stem cell biology and develops biomimetic systems for use in regenerative medicine. Dr. Jangs lab studies both basic aspects of stem cell biology, especially systemic/metabolic regulations of stem cell and stem cell niche, as well as more translational aspects of muscle stem cell and mesenchymal stem cell for use in therapeutic approaches for musculoskeletal aging, neuromuscular diseases, and traumatic injuries.
